Changes to Soil Sample Services

The UW Soil and Forage Lab in Marshfield has closed and all UW soil samples are being processed at the Madison, WI lab. Due to this, the Extension Wood County office will no longer be accepting soil samples. We apologize for any inconvenience this may cause. While we are not able to accept soil samples […]

Wood County Rural Economic Development Plan

Over the last year and a half, Community Development Educator, Nancy Turyk, worked with Wood County staff and supervisors along with numerous county organizations and individuals to develop Wood County’s first-ever Economic Development Plan. After unanimous approval by the Wood County Board in early April, the Economic Development Plan will now act as a guiding […]
